Description
Key Features
In-depth sociological analysis of the medical elite in America following the tradition of C. Wright Mills.
Direct observational study based on over a year of living with interns at the Harvard Medical Unit.
Detailed accounts of medical training across hospital wards, clinics, and accident floors.
Primary source insights gathered through interviews with interns and hospital administrators.
Examination of how the next generation of physicians will shape the character of medicine.
